It’s official: Buy PSPgo and get 10 games free

June 1, 2010 By Kunal Gangar Leave a Comment

  UPDATE: The offer below is applicable to consumers in Europe. For American PSPgo buyers, Sony is giving LittleBigPlanet, Ratchet and Clank: Size Matters and SOCOM: Fireteam Bravo 3 as free downloads. This offer runs through March 31, 2011. Sony just went ahead and announced to offer 10 free games with purchase of your PSPgo. […]

Qualcomm starts shipping 1.2GHz dual-core Snapdragon chipset

June 1, 2010 By Kinjal Sangoi Leave a Comment

  Qualcomm has started shipping samples of new Snapdragon SoCs that integrate two processor cores. The two third-gen dual-core Snapdragon SoCs, MSM8260 for HSPA+ and MSM8660 for multi-mode HSPA+/CDMA2000 1xEV-DO Rev. B runs at a clock speed of up to 1.2GHz and features GPU with 3D/2D acceleration engines for Open GLES 2.0, Open VG 1.1 […]

Hitachi-LG integrates SSD on Optical Drive, calls it HyDrive

June 1, 2010 By Kunal Gangar Leave a Comment

  Hitachi-LG Data Storage (HLDS) has unveiled an interesting product at the Computex in Taipei. The HyDrive is basically an optical drive (DVD or Blu-ray) but comes with an embedded SSD storage, thus giving the advantages of SSD without taking up additional space. The current-gen HyDrive is expected in August this year where South Korea-based […]
